When it comes to stretch marks, most individuals seem to have problems. Stretch mark is a scar on the skin because of overstretching and most people do not know this. This is a result of sudden growth in the body which the skin can’t handle. What happens is that the dermal layer is torn which causes these. The lines that you see on the skin are in fact scars from tearing of the skin layer.

Scars like these are not like any other scars that you see on your body. People have difficulties in treating them because these are internal scars. Since most people are very conscious of the way that their skin looks, they really take all the effort to try all the techniques to remove these scars.

There are a lot of creams being sold in the market that actually remove these scars. These topical creams actually work by increasing skin cell regeneration. There are nutrients which are supplied on the skin making it look healthier and more beautiful. With constant application of these creams, you can expect that the scars will begin to disappear.

Microdermabrasion is an exfoliation techniques that removes the topmost layer of the skin. This is where dead skin cells are found. This method of removal is very effective as it stimulates the regeneration of new skin that can cover up the scars. With constant treatment, you will notice how your scars will eventually fade.

Laser treatment is an expensive yet effective treatment for removal of stretch marks. This treatment is expensive because it works faster and without pain. It can make the stretch marks dissapear because laser treatment works directly on the scars in the dermal layer. The cost may be high but these treatments can instantly make your skin look more beautiful.

Stretch marks usually occurs on pregnant women. More than 80% of new mothers have to live with theses post pregnancy scars for at least a few weeks. Despite the fact that these marks are harmless, women feel very embarrassed to live with those ugly marks. It is an extremely unavoidable condition unless you are proactive to prevent them in the first place. There are various treatments to get rid of them but once the marks start darkening it becomes more difficult to remove them. Since there’s undeniably an increase in the weight during pregnancy, women can prevent these. As early as the first trimester, women should take all of the necessary safety measures to avoid stretch marks from forming. They always have to maintain moisturized skin to maintain its elasticity.

The best way to get rid of stretch mark is to prevent it. This can be done by massaging and exfoliating your skin form the second trimester onwards. As the unborn baby starts taking nutrition from your body, you need to keep replenishing them regularly. Diet rich in Vitamin E apart from leafy vegetable and fresh fruits go a long way in preventing the formation of striae.
